The extra $190 gets you;

Dark Tides Scenario Book
GM Screen
Wrath Card Deck
Campaign Card Deck
Perils of the Warp Card Deck
Combat Complications Card Deck
Wrath & Glory Digital Soundtrack
3 Double-Sided Battle Maps (1 large, 2 medium)
Beginner’s Rulebook and a new Starter Adventure (“Escape Da Rok”)
6 Pre-Generated Characters on Deluxe Character Sheets
20 Ceramic Poker Chip-Style Counters for Wrath, Glory, and Ruin
Acrylic Tokens for Characters, Enemies, and NPCs
Exclusive Collectors Box
5 Extra dice

More info...

Wrath Card Deck – This card deck details numerous brutal critical hits for combat in Wrath & Glory, plus they are useful for determining the outcome of a threatening task (situations where the entire warband works together to complete steps towards resolving a dangerous situation).

Campaign Card Deck – These cards put some narrative control into the players hands for games of Wrath & Glory. Each card’s effects are immersive into the universe of Warhammer 40,000 and help connect the player to the themes and tropes of the setting.

Perils of the Warp Card Deck – Using psychic powers are dangerous in the 41st Millennium. Unfortunate psykers may manifest all manner of bizarre and sinister phenomena… and this card deck details the horrific events that ensue.

Combat Complications Card Deck – In Wrath & Glory, rolling a complication during a test means that the situation changes – usually becoming more difficult or problematic for the character. This deck is useful for when a complication is rolled in combat and contains many example situations that may occur.

Talents and Psychic Powers Card Pack – This card deck contains handy reference material for a character’s talents or psychic powers that they may possess.

Gear Card Pack – This card contains handy references for weapons, armour, and other important wargear for Wrath & Glory characters.


From their forum:

One of the employees (Eric) answered my question, when I asked if the contents of the card packs would be included in the Core Rulebook (as tables or rules sections, for instance) or if the contents would only be available via the cards themselves. I received the following answer:
---- ---- ---- ---- ----
The Campaign Card Deck is entirely separate and not duplicated in the book. That's because those cards are drawn and played by the players rather than triggered by events. The other decks are covered with tables, but the tables of course don't include the nice art or the feel of drawing them from a deck.

The other advantage of the card deck is that it can grow and change over time with promos or expansions.
